The admission process for M.Tech in Electronics and Telecommunication Engineering typically involves several stages. Firstly, candidates must meet the eligibility criteria, which usually includes a Bachelor's degree in a relevant field like Electronics, Electrical, or Telecommunication Engineering with a minimum aggregate score (often 60% or equivalent CGPA). Secondly, most reputed institutes require candidates to have a valid GATE (Graduate Aptitude Test in Engineering) score. Some universities also conduct their own entrance exams. The selection process often involves a combination of GATE score, performance in the entrance exam (if applicable), and academic record. Shortlisted candidates may be called for an interview or counseling session.

Several entrance exams are crucial for securing admission to M.Tech programs in Electronics and Telecommunication Engineering in India. The most prominent is the GATE (Graduate Aptitude Test in Engineering). A good GATE score significantly increases your chances of admission into IITs, NITs, and other top engineering colleges. Besides GATE, some universities conduct their own entrance exams. For instance, state-level engineering colleges might have their own entrance tests. Private universities like BITS Pilani and VIT also conduct their own entrance exams for M.Tech admissions.

The fee structure for M.Tech in Electronics and Telecommunication Engineering varies significantly depending on the type of institution (government, private, or deemed university) and its ranking. Government colleges like IITs and NITs generally have lower tuition fees compared to private institutions. The total fees can range from INR 50,000 per year in government colleges to INR 2,00,000 or more per year in private colleges. Besides tuition fees, students may also need to pay for other expenses such as hostel accommodation, mess charges, examination fees, and library fees. Some colleges also charge a one-time admission fee or caution deposit.
